Compounding pharmacies make customized medicines for individual patients, and under section 503A of the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act, a pharmacy can compound from a bulk substance only if that substance has an official quality monograph, is a component of an FDA-approved drug, or has been formally added to an approved bulks list. BPC-157 qualifies on none of those counts, which is why the FDA placed it in Category 2 of its 503A bulk-substance review in September of 2023
